United States President Barack Obama recently elevated Dr Rajiv Shah, who currently serves as Under Secretary for Research, Education and Economics and Chief Scientist at the United States Department of Agriculture, as administrator for the United States Agency for International Development. Earlier, the Obama administration had named Shah's wife, Shivam Mallick Shah as Director of Special Initiatives, Office of Innovation and Improvement at the Department of Education.
